Avancées récentes sur la reproduction des huîtres ArchiMer
Gerard, Andre.
Historically, the research on mollusc reproduction conducted by the Ifremer aimed at improving mass production in order to support new activities (Japanese clam for example) or to compensate for insufficient natural reproductions (abalone, king scallop). Nowadays, priority has been given to the preservation of natural resources and the optimisation of shellfish culture in order to support activities that are strongly represented by a profession, especially oyster culture. The studies that have been carried out in the field of oyster genetics for about ten years highlighted the limits of our knowledge on reproduction control as well as the high sensitivity of mollusc farms to the multiple assaults of their outside environment. Contrôle de la gamétogénèse des huîtres creuses et plates. Relations "reproduction" et "génétique" ArchiMer
Gerard, Andre; Naciri-graven, Yamama; Boudry, Pierre; Launey, Sophie; Heurtebise, Serge; Ledu, Christophe; Phelipot, Pascal.
At the end of the 1980s, after two decades of aquaculture research in molluscs, Ifremer initiated its first genetic studies. These new studies quickly revealed the limits of knowledge in aquaculture, particularly in terms of controlling oyster reproduction. This presentation attempts to summarize the available information on genetics in aquaculture. In particular, breeding practices in the 1980s involved populations of broodstock, while genetics requires modern techniques where individuals, not just populations, can be identified. Diversité génétique et dynamique du recrutement chez l'huître plate Ostrea edulis L. ArchiMer
Lapegue, Sylvie; Boudry, Pierre; Mira, Sara; Taris, Nicolas; Bonhomme, Francois.
In order to understand better some fundamental aspects of the bivalve biology, one has to pay attention to the variance of their breeding success, the time structure of the populations and their effective size. An abundant literature shows the existence of a heterozygote deficit as well as positive relationships between heterozygoty and fitness components. This last point is the subject of explanatory hypotheses which have never been clearly decided between until now. One of these hypotheses is the possible existence of a certain degree of inbreeding among those populations.
